The benefit to Hooray is approximately 50% of the value of the coupons sold to its customer. The customers will benefit from discounts ranging from 50% to 90%. Business partners will benefit from increased sales resulting in a win-win situation for all parties. The value of each deal ranges between £10 and £30 so we expect on average £20 to be spent by each of our customers with 50% of that being our revenue. Therefore, we expect to earn an average of £10 from each of our deals.

Hooray is expected to be up and running by June 2011. Our target customers are university students, housewives and white-collar workers in and around London. We expected to work with major supermarket chains like Tesco, Sainsbury, Airlines and Travel companies like Thomas Cook operating in and around London. We will also be working with a variety of upscale restaurants in London and on the Campuses of various Universities as well as entertainment companies like movie theatres and opera houses.

Our starting point will be in London where we expect to get between 20,000 and 100,000 subscribers in our first month of operation and between 20,000 and 100,000 coupons sold bringing in an average of between £200,000 in a worst-case scenario and £1,000,000 in a best-case scenario in terms of revenues. We expect to have between 500 thousand and one million subscribers by the end of May 2012. All first-time subscribers will get an opportunity of obtaining their deals free if at least three of their friends use their link on subscribing to purchase coupons.

Students on various university campuses will be able to buy weekly deals for £30 for meals for five days at the university cafeteria. If they allow at least five other students to use their link they get free meals for the week. White-collar workers will benefit from daily lunch deals at various restaurants in and around London. Housewives will benefit tremendously from deals at major supermarkets, especially on items that are slow-moving and in some cases soon to expire.
